Advanced Surgical Techniques



When it involves cataract surgical treatment, progressed medical methods have actually revolutionized the method this common treatment is executed. With the introduction of phacoemulsification, a minimally intrusive treatment, doctors can currently make smaller incisions, leading to quicker recovery times and decreased risk of issues. This technique makes use of ultrasound to break up the cloudy lens, which is after that removed through a tiny probe.

In addition, the use of femtosecond laser modern technology has actually enhanced the accuracy of cataract surgery by helping in creating exact lacerations and softening the cataract for simpler elimination.

In addition, the introduction of intraocular lenses (IOLs) that correct astigmatism and presbyopia during cataract surgery has actually additionally enhanced individual outcomes. These innovative lenses can deal with refractive errors, minimizing the need for glasses or get in touch with lenses post-surgery. Doctors now have the ability to customize the selection of IOL to every person's special visual needs, ensuring a much more tailored and satisfying result.
